Before we jump into categorizing online gambling, let’s quickly define it. Online gambling refers to any activity where participants participate in games of chance or skill through an Internet-connected computer such as casino gambling, sports betting, or poker; its appeal lies in its convenience, accessibility, and thrilling experience offered to participants.

Categorized By Type of Games

Casino Games: These websites feature both classic and contemporary casino games such as slot machines and table games such as blackjack and roulette.

Sports Betting: Betting platforms that specialize in providing players the chance to gamble on various sporting events.
